ROLE OVERVIEW

We are looking for a detail-oriented and analytically strong Financial Analyst to join our Strategic Finance team, reporting to the Strategic Finance Leader for the Field. This is a high-impact, execution-focused role at the core of how we support the Sales organization — you'll own the monthly and quarterly close process, budgeting and forecasting, sales performance analysis (including commission payout reconciliation), and expense management. The foundation of this role is rigorous FP&A work: getting the numbers right, surfacing the right insights, and building the operational infrastructure that lets the business run well.

Please note: This is an in-office/hybrid role requiring regular on-site presence in San Francisco; only candidates currently living in the area will be considered.

RESPONSIBILITIES

- Build and maintain full year budgets and quarterly forecasts for various Field Organizations (Sales, Solution Consulting, Sales Operations & Enablement, and Marketing)

- Deliver monthly/quarterly analyses of financial results including BvA variances to plan, ensuring key issues, risks and business drivers are understood and proactively highlighted

- Support commissions calculations and reporting, analytics and support annual comp plan design

- Support the company-wide annual and long-range planning processes

- Partner with Accounting on monthly close activities such as vendor trend reviews, closed-won opportunities, collections, and commissions payments

- Develop and continually improve sales and customer metrics (revenue, ARR, ASP, seat penetration, quota attainment etc.)

- Partner with business leaders to drive strategic initiatives influencing business decisions and by providing proactive recommendations, backed by strong business and financial analysis

- Drive ad-hoc projects and analysis to support Benchling’s long-term growth

QUALIFICATIONS

- Bachelor’s degree in Business, Finance, Accounting, Economics or equivalent area.

- 2–5 years of FP&A or Strategic Finance experience, with at least 2 years supporting a Sales, Marketing or GTM org at a SaaS company.

- Strong understanding and substantial knowledge of complex financial modeling, GAAP accounting and FP&A best practices

- Strong Communication Skills - ability to think logically, rationally, and strategically in order to distill and articulate complex data to drive business decisions. Experience presenting analyses to management and ability to lead and drive initiatives

- Proficiency in Excel/Sheets and a planning tool (Adaptive, Anaplan, or equivalent) required. Salesforce and Certinia experience is a strong plus.
